The Assassination of Saint Peter Martyr

Cornelis Cort, after Titian

National Gallery of Art

The image shows an elevated and slightly angled view capturing figures in a landscape. Trees obscure the high horizon, the intricately engraved textures enhancing details in vegetation, clothing, and tree bark. The monochrome color palette accentuates contrast for form and depth. Two robed figures struggle on a slope, framed by trees, while another figure gestures with a sword nearby. Leafy trees fill the background, blending into a sky with clouds.
